xserver-xorg-conf: htcdream: switch to htcdream version of the US keyboard

The htcdream has an hardware keyboard with some key binded to
  alt+key,for instance alt+q should produce a Tab.

Before we didn't activate that feature, and instead we used
  the US keyboard default.

This feature depend on xkeyboard-config_git which is the default
  for most openembedded based distributions now.

This change only affect the htcdream's xorg.conf and PR was bumped.
